【摘要】 利用交流阻抗技术快速评价人工破损涂层的性能 ,并探讨颜料的防锈作用机理

【Abstract】 Electrochemical Impedance Spectroscopy (EIS) was applied to rapidly evaluate the performance of organic coatings and the characterization of the protective properties of anticorrosive pigments in the presence of artificial defect in organic coatings. The results showed that artificial defect method can rapidly evaluate the performance of coatings and discriminate whether the pigments in the coatings have inhibitive.
